Hi Rack,

I was under the impression your weight was stable?

Are carbs riding high? I look night and day when flitting between high carb and lower carb days. I could have a few large carb meals and smooth over badly and test the worksmanship of my work trousers button. However, I could up my fat intake and lower my CHO intake for a few days and my stomach would flatten out immensly and a few cheeky lines would come out.

for me it is nothing more than a physiological response to CHO intake.  

You may be finding that all the extra food is bloating you out a little more than expected?

honestly mate, i think all you would gain by letting yourself get massive would be alot of extra fat to diet off.  Aaron, for all that he gained alot of fat, also has some very good genetics for piling on the muscle, so if your comparing yourself to him, its always going to mess with your head.  It does mine mate, given i have been bodybuilding and very strict with it for years and years, and still nowhere near the mass i want, despite being on for a long time.  Then someone comes along and blows what little mass i have out of the water bigtime in just a few months!

all you can do is work with what you have mate, trying to do anything else just fcuks your head up, trust me on that one!

put some cardio into training routine mate, 30 minutes straight away after weights at about 110-130bpm.  Will help keep you trim, and improve fitness, and as i found out mood as well!

ignore the weight, im half an inch shorter than you, and have never weighed more than just over 15 and a half.  im sat at just over 13 stone at the moment mate, and everyone, and i do mean everyone is commenting on how good i look.  Its taken me nearly ten years to finally be able to ignore the numbers on the scales, but i feel like im free from the shackles of fat that i was holding to keep the numbers high/move them up.
